Android vs iOS屏幕共享:谁才是社交神器?
Android vs iOS屏幕共享:谁才是社交神器?
在数字化时代,屏幕共享技术已成为实现实时互动和远程协作的关键工具。无论是Android还是iOS,都有各自的屏幕共享技术,适用于家庭娱乐、办公协作、教育培训等多个场景。Android通过HID协议实现屏幕分享,而iOS则依靠ReplayKit框架。那么,究竟哪个系统的屏幕共享技术更适合社交互动呢?让我们从技术原理、使用场景、用户体验和安全性四个方面进行深入对比。
技术原理对比
Android的屏幕共享主要依赖于Miracast和Scrcpy等技术。Miracast是一种基于WiFi Direct的无线显示标准,支持将智能手机、平板电脑和笔记本电脑等设备内容投射到大屏幕电视或其他显示设备上。Scrcpy则是一种开源命令行工具,通过ADB连接实现屏幕共享,画质好、延迟低。
iOS的屏幕共享则主要通过ReplayKit框架实现。ReplayKit允许开发者创建Broadcast Upload Extension,实现屏幕录制和分享。iOS 12.0引入RPSystemBroadcastPickerView,提供系统级屏幕分享启动器,但目前尚不支持自定义界面。
使用场景对比
在家庭娱乐场景中,Android设备可以通过Miracast将手机画面投射到电视等大屏幕设备上,实现无线投屏。iOS设备则可以通过AirPlay实现类似功能,但需要Apple TV或支持AirPlay的电视。
在办公协作场景中,Android设备可以通过ToDesk等软件实现多设备扩展屏,将手机或平板变成电脑的第二块屏幕。iOS设备则可以通过Universal Control实现类似功能,但需要macOS和iPadOS的配合。
在教育培训场景中,Android设备可以通过DLNA协议实现多媒体内容的无线传输,iOS设备则可以通过ReplayKit实现屏幕录制和分享,便于教学内容的制作和分享。
用户体验对比
在易用性方面,Android的Miracast和iOS的AirPlay都提供了较为简便的使用方式,但需要设备支持相应的协议。Scrcpy的使用则需要一定的技术背景,不适合普通用户。iOS的ReplayKit提供了系统级的屏幕分享启动器,使用更为便捷。
在稳定性方面,Android的Miracast在P2P模式下容易出现丢帧、花屏现象,而Scrcpy的使用则依赖于ADB连接的稳定性。iOS的ReplayKit则提供了较为稳定的屏幕录制和分享功能。
在兼容性方面,Android的Miracast和Scrcpy支持多种设备和操作系统,而iOS的ReplayKit仅支持苹果设备。
安全性对比
Android 15将引入敏感内容保护功能,可以隐藏私人消息等敏感数据。iOS则通过系统级隐私设置和权限管理,提供全面的隐私保护。两者都提供了较为完善的安全保障,但iOS的隐私保护机制更为成熟和完善。
结论
Android和iOS的屏幕共享技术各有优劣。Android的屏幕共享技术在兼容性和灵活性方面具有优势,适合技术爱好者和需要跨平台协作的用户。iOS的屏幕共享技术则在易用性和隐私保护方面表现更佳,适合普通用户和对隐私有较高要求的用户。选择哪种屏幕共享技术,主要取决于用户的使用场景和需求。